Abstract
<p><i>The Australian Securities and Investment Commission (ASIC) aims to regulate poor corporate culture in the financial services industry. This article critically analyses the regulator’s ongoing statements about corporate culture of financial institutions. Unlike the UK, Australia has not legislated or implemented any regulation to address the issues. The following research will offer insight to regulatory solutions.</i></p>
